Hungary – not playing by EU rules

    

 

Hungary under Viktor Orban has been accused by the EU parliament over breaches of the EU’s core values – attacks on the media, minorities, and the rule of law. All hotly denied. More than two-thirds of MEPs backed the censure motion – the first such vote against a member state under EU rules – and it now has to go to national leaders with the likelihood of a split between conservatives and nationalists on whether to pursue punitive measures.
